About Buckeye, Arizona

Buckeye is a locality in Maricopa County, Arizona, United States. With a population of 104,923, Buckeye is a major urban centre in Arizona. The population density is 97.5 people per km². Buckeye is located at 33.3703°N, 112.5838°W. It observes the Mountain Standard Time — no DST (America/Phoenix) timezone. ZIP code: 85326.

Buckeye, Arizona, unfolds across a broad expanse of Sonoran Desert, its landscape defined by rugged mountains and wide, arroyo-scarred plains. It lies 13.8 miles west-south-west of Goodyear, AZ (from Goodyear, AZ: bearing 251°T), and is situated 14.2 miles west-south-west of Avondale.
